> I started using your system and I have come to firewall configuration. Can
> you tell me how to configure firewall (pf) that I will be able to connect
> with the computer through SSH on port 1024.
> 

That depends on what else you are trying to accomplish.  The simplest approach is to change the Port parameter in /etc/ssh/sshd_config.  Then you don't need to do anything with pf.  However, if you are filtering other things with pf you might want to consider blocking port 22 in pf and then redirecting port 1024 to port 22 on the local machine.  The best way depends on what else you plan on doing.
